    What Happens to Shoplifters in Court
    My question involves criminal law for the state of: california

    I was just wondering trying to help my friend out she was caught shoplifting and her court date is coming up.. its her first offense.. i was just wondering whats going to happened to her at the court she said she didnt still less than $50 and we did some research already.. her parents dont know about it either... shes already 25 so yah.

    Re: Who Expirenced Petty Theft/Shoplifting in Ca. What to Expect in Court
    She needs a lawyer. If she can't afford one, plead not guilty and ask for a public defender (there will be a payback obligation). Ask about a First Time Offenders program.

    She can expect court costs and fines, possibly Community Service (she gets to pay for that privilege), possibly an anti-theft class that she would pay for.

    Also, the store will be sending a Civil Demand. This is separate from the criminal charge and needs to be paid immediately.
